The Batgirl character was in fact cerated by "Batman" creator Bob Kane and first appeared in a November, 1966 issue of "Detective Comics".
This presentation was probably filmed to convince ABC to allow the producers to "keep up" with the comic book and introduce Batgirl in the 1967/68 season.
BTW, Killer Moth was the villian in the comic-book story that introduced Batgirl, but never appeared in the series.
